Located in an enviable position, on the 6th floor of the iconic Mirage on Harbour Road. This prestigious apartment is one of only a few that offers far reaching views down the length of the marina from a large terrace to enjoy the best of the British weather.

There is lift access from the ground floor where there is a secure allocated parking space for use of the owner. There is also secure communal bike and bin storage for use of the residence of the building.

When entering the apartment, you are greeted with a spacious 'L shaped' hallway with a large utility cupboard with plumbing for the washing machine and storage. There are doors leading onto the two double bedrooms, the master benefitting from an ensuite shower room and fitted wardrobes. There is a three-piece family bathroom with panel bath, wall mounted WC and floating wash hand basin.

The main living space has light flooding in from the dual aspect floor to ceiling windows and really is the jewel in the crown. There is a fitted kitchen to one end with integrated appliances and ample worktop and cupboard space. There is room enough for a 6-seater dining table and a comfortable living area with a door into the balcony which faces directly onto the marina.

    Broadband availability and predicted speed: obtained from Ofcom on February 10, 2023

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ile phone signal availability and predicted strength: obtained from Ofcom on February 10, 2023

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
